Output a434417faf2732b350ecf6f62c84a0fe8d87c6aefa0ec4b9ecfccc3499d66a87:0

value
2690800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d417c73ad2e0561dbf2aa275d28264c164fc4a94 OP_EQUAL
address
3M2TfMRfBEJahrEdaP9TNbqLVfhk9evRjc
transaction
a434417faf2732b350ecf6f62c84a0fe8d87c6aefa0ec4b9ecfccc3499d66a87
confirmations
132279
spent
true